cyclooxygenase <enzyme> An enzyme protein complex present in most tissues that catalyses two steps in prostaglandin biosynthesis and produces prostaglandins and thromboxanes from arachidonic acid.
The cyclooxygenase activity converts arachidonate and 2O2 to prostaglandin G2; the hydroperoxidase activity uses glutathione to convert prostaglandin G2 to prostaglandin H2.
The cyclooxygenase activity is inhibited by aspirin like drugs, accounting for their anti-inflammatory effects.
Synonym: prostaglandin endoperoxide synthase.

  • Cyclin-Dependent Kinase Inhibitor p15 - »õâ An INK4 cyclin-dependent kinase inhibitor containing four ANKYRIN-LIKE REPEATS. INK4B is often inactivated by deletions, mutations, or hypermethylation in HEMATOLOGIC NEOPLASMS.
    Synonyms : CDKN2B Protein, Cyclin-Dependent Kinase Inhibitor 2B, INK4B Protein, INK4b Cyclin-Dependent Kinase Inhibitor, p15 CDK4 Inhibitor, p15INK4B Protein, CDK4 Inhibitor, p15, Cyclin Dependent Kinase Inhibitor 2B, Cyclin Dependent Kinase Inhibitor p15
  • Cyclin-Dependent Kinase Inhibitor p16 - »õâ A product of the p16 tumor suppressor gene (GENES, P16). It is also called INK4 or INK4A because it is the prototype member of the INK4 CYCLIN-DEPENDENT KINASE INHIBITORS. This protein is produced from the alpha mRNA transcript of the p16 gene. The other gene product, produced from the alternatively spliced beta transcript, is TUMOR SUPPRESSOR PROTEIN P14ARF. Both p16 gene products have tumor suppressor functions.
    Synonyms : CDKN2 Protein, CDKN2A Protein, Cdk4-Associated Protein p16, Cyclin-Dependent Kinase Inhibitor-2A, INK4A Protein, MTS1 Protein, Multiple Tumor Suppressor-1, p16(INK4A), p16INK4 Protein, p16INK4A Protein, Cdk4 Associated Protein p16, Multiple Tumor Suppressor 1
  • Cyclin-Dependent Kinase Inhibitor p18 - »õâ An INK4 cyclin-dependent kinase inhibitor containing five ANKYRIN-LIKE REPEATS. Aberrant expression of this protein has been associated with deregulated EPITHELIAL CELL growth, organ enlargement, and a variety of NEOPLASMS.
    Synonyms : CDK6-Associated Protein p18, CDKN2C Protein, Cyclin-Dependent Kinase Inhibitor 2C, INK4C Protein, p18 CDK6 Inhibitor, p18INK4c Protein, CDK6 Associated Protein p18, CDK6 Inhibitor, p18, Cyclin Dependent Kinase Inhibitor 2C, Cyclin Dependent Kinase Inhibitor p18
  • Cyclin-Dependent Kinase Inhibitor p19 - »õâ An INK4 cyclin-dependent kinase inhibitor containing five ANKYRIN REPEATS. Aberrant expression of this protein has been associated with TESTICULAR CANCER.
    Synonyms : CDKN2D Protein, Cyclin-Dependent Kinase Inhibitor 2D, INK4D Protein, p19INK4D Protein, Cyclin Dependent Kinase Inhibitor 2D, Cyclin Dependent Kinase Inhibitor p19
  • Cyclin-Dependent Kinase Inhibitor p21 - »õâ A cyclin-dependent kinase inhibitor that mediates TUMOR SUPRESSOR PROTEIN P53-dependent CELL CYCLE arrest. p21 interacts with a range of CYCLIN-DEPENDENT KINASES and associates with PROLIFERATING CELL NUCLEAR ANTIGEN and CASPASE 3.
    Synonyms : CDK2-Associated Protein 20 kDa, CDKN1 Protein, CDKN1A Protein, Cdk-Interacting Protein 1, Cdk2 Inhibitor Protein, Cell Cycle Regulator p21, Cyclin Kinase Inhibitor p21, Cyclin-Dependent Kinase Inhibitor 1A Protein, Senescent Cell-Derived Inhibitor Protein 1
